The 
Galdhøpiggen mountain is the highest point in 
Norway, at 2469 m above sea level. It is located within the municipality of 
Lom, in the 
Jotunheimen[?] mountain area. The access to Galdhøpiggen is not especially hard: 4 hours walk up, 2 hours down. From the summit, 35000 km² of area is visible.
